WestCanMan Posted April 21 Report Posted April 21 For those of you who still doubt the value of using fake polling and fake news to change the outcome of elections, consider the Asch experiment: https://www.simplypsychology.org/asch-conformity.html Solomon Asch designed an experiment to see how much pressure to conform would influence people to give a blatantly wrong answer to a simple question. He chose a question so simple that only 1% of people got it wrong in 6 different control groups, where there were no influencers. Then he asked the same question to 12 different groups of people where the first 6 people to answer had all agreed to give the same wrong answer, and the 7th person to answer was left unaware. The inaccuracy of the 7th person went from 1% - the avg rate of incorrect answers in the control groups - to 32% in the test groups. Only 25% of people would never get sucked in even after doing the test multiple times. That's what social pressure does to the avg human.
